Prime Buy Alderon 2010697 FLEX Single Phase Duplex 7 - 15 Amps Review

The Prime Buy Alderon 2010697 FLEX Single Phase Duplex Controller is a $799.00 industrial-grade pump control system designed for managing and monitoring pump operations in both indoor and outdoor environments. It operates on 120/230VAC with a 7-15 amp range and is housed in a durable Type 4X enclosure with a pad-lockable, weather-resistant design and a clear door for easy viewing of the OLED status display.

This system includes advanced features such as pump circuit breakers, relay starters, surge protection, and automatic resettable fuses, ensuring reliable and safe operation. It offers configurable pump control modes like demand dosing and timed dosing, along with support for multiple sensors and up to five digital inputs. 

Users can monitor detailed system statistics such as pump run times, cycle counts, and total output via a password-protected interface. Additional features include alarm indicators, a test/silence switch, HOA (Hand-Off-Auto) controls, and customizable alerts, making it a highly configurable solution for pump management and monitoring.

Prime Buy Milwaukee Compact Drill Kit Review

The Milwaukee Tool 2606-22CT M18 Compact 1/2" Drill Driver Kit is a $307.40 cordless power tool set designed for professional-grade drilling and driving tasks. It includes the M18 Compact Drill Driver (2606-20), a multi-voltage charger, two REDLITHIUM™ CP1.5 battery packs, and a carrying case. The drill features a compact 7-1/4" design, making it easier to work in tight spaces while still delivering strong performance.

Powered by a 4-pole frameless motor, the drill produces up to 500 in-lbs of torque and speeds of 0-400 / 0-1,800 RPM, offering both power and control. It also includes an all-metal gear case and chuck for durability, along with REDLINK™ Intelligence, which protects the tool from overload and optimizes performance. The system is compatible with over 150 M18 cordless tools, and the batteries feature fuel gauges and all-weather performance for reliable use in demanding jobsite conditions.

Prime Buy Datalogic ADC GBT4500-BK-WLC Gryphon Review

The Datalogic ADC GBT4500-BK-WLC Gryphon is a $430.50 wireless 2D barcode scanner designed for professional use, particularly in environments such as healthcare and retail. It features a high-performance 2D megapixel imager and supports wireless charging, offering convenient, cable-free operation.

Built for durability, the device has an IP52-rated casing and can withstand repeated drops from up to 1.8 meters (6 feet) onto concrete. It is specifically designed with chemical-resistant materials, making it suitable for environments that require frequent cleaning. The scanner is highly versatile, capable of reading 1D, 2D, postal, stacked, Digimarc, and DotCode barcodes, all in a single easy-to-use device.

Prime Buy Return Policy

Customers can generally request returns within 14 days of delivery, but eligibility depends on the specific product and manufacturer rules, so some items may be non-returnable or have special conditions listed on the product page. 

Returns require an RMA approval, and items must be in complete, unused, resellable condition with original packaging and accessories. Customers are responsible for ensuring product compatibility before purchase, and non-defective returns may be subject to a restocking fee of up to 30%.

Defective, wrong, or damaged items are handled separately: defective products are typically eligible for replacement without restocking fees, while wrong or shipping-damaged items must be reported quickly with proof (such as photos) and returned using the provided instructions. 

All returns are inspected upon arrival, and refunds or replacements are processed only after approval. Unauthorized returns, missing packaging, or policy violations may result in rejection, return shipping charges, or additional fees.

Prime Buy Shipping Policy

Prime Buy ships only within the U.S., U.S. territories, and APO/FPO/DPO addresses, and does not deliver to P.O. Boxes. Customers can choose between Standard Shipping (1-7 business days via UPS/FedEx Ground) and Expedited Shipping (3-day delivery via UPS/FedEx Express services), though delivery times refer only to transit and do not include processing or handling time. Orders are typically processed within 2-5 business days, and shipping times may vary due to stock availability, handling requirements, or external delays.

Shipping costs depend on package size, destination, and service type, and are shown at checkout. Some items qualify for free standard shipping within the continental U.S., but additional fees may apply for special services like residential delivery, liftgate, or inside delivery. 

Customers are responsible for any hazardous material fees, customs (if applicable), and missed delivery storage costs, and must be present for certain large-item deliveries. Tracking information is provided after shipment, and signature confirmation may be required upon delivery.
